Mets Re-Assign Zack Wheeler, Nine Others, To Minor League Camp
Top pitching prospect Zack Wheeler was among the casualties in the first round of major league cuts in Mets camp this morning. Wheeler and nine others were re-assigned to minor league camp. Wheeler, 22, has made only one appearance so far this spring on February 23, when he struck out two in two innings. He …

Outfield Prospect Cesar Puello Linked To Miami Biogenesis Clinic
A new report by T.J. Quinn and Mike Fish of ESPN uncovers new names linked to the controversial biogenesis clinic in Miami. Among the names are top Mets outfield prospect Cesar Puello. Documents obtained by ESPN indicate that both Puello paid the clinic $1,000 last March. Puello is a client of ACES, a sports agency …
